Course description

This online course is an adaptation of our existing popular course Introduction to Software for Medical Devices and IEC 62304 with a special focus on developing Software as a Medical Device (SaMD). 

Topics of the course include how to efficiently plan and document software development, getting requirements right, how to approach software architecture and software risk management, and how to perform software safety classification correctly . 

SaMD specific topics include software types and terminology, product requirements in IEC 82304-1, how to manage cybersecurity and artificial intelligence.

The course looks at the development aspects of the IEC 62304 standard. It also includes an introduction to the IEC 82304-1 standard and its relation to ISO 13485 (quality management). In the course, you will also learn about the relationship to ISO 14971 (risk management) when developing medical device software.

The course is suitable for anyone working with SaMD development, such as R&D engineers, quality assurance department and auditors of SaMD. The course does not cover actual coding.
